Nigel Quashie

Nigel Francis Quashie ( born July 20, 1978 in Nunhead ) is a Scottish football player. The midfielder currently plays for Queens Park Rangers in the second highest English football league, the Football League Championship.

He began his career in London with Queens Park Rangers. In December 1995 he made his debut against Manchester United at Old Trafford. For the 1998/99 season he moved for £ 2.5 million to Nottingham Forest, where he scored two goals in 43 games in two years. In August 2000, Portsmouth had over £ 600,000 for the midfielder. Portsmouth has been the longest stage of his career, he remained there from 2000 to 2005, completed 148 games and scored 13 goals.

In the 2005/06 season he played for Southampton FC, moved for one and a half years to West Bromwich Albion and then to West Ham United. On 22 January 2010, he joined a free transfer from West Ham United to his original club, Queens Park Rangers.

After he made ​​a few U21 caps for England, he joined the Association as Berti Vogts gave him to play for Scotland the chance. He made his debut against Estonia, in his second game against Trinidad & Tobago, he scored a goal in a 4-1 victory.
